Output 876060fb6f9ea93ec2232026405b6f52da62ae0e39eafe640a51dd77d415e1bf:0

value
6938325664552
script pubkey
OP_0 OP_PUSHBYTES_20 e7983d0e56794933d744ed965aac52b322561f47
address
tb1qu7vr6rjk09yn846yakt94tzjkv39v868nncczu
transaction
876060fb6f9ea93ec2232026405b6f52da62ae0e39eafe640a51dd77d415e1bf
confirmations
179165
spent
true